Signs Your Great Wall Transmission Needs Attention

Great Wall automatic transmissions can develop issues that are worth catching early. Watch for these warning signs:

  • Delayed engagement when shifting into Drive or Reverse
  • Slipping gears, where the engine revs but the car doesn’t accelerate smoothly
  • Jerking or shuddering during gear changes
  • Transmission fluid that smells burnt or looks dark and dirty
  • Warning lights on the dashboard related to the transmission
  • Unusual noises from under the vehicle when the gearbox is in gear
  • Difficulty shifting or the selector feeling stiff or stuck

If you’ve noticed any of these symptoms in your Great Wall, bring it in for a diagnostic check. Many transmission issues start small and get worse quickly if ignored. Early detection often means the difference between a fluid and filter service and a major repair.

What We Include in a Great Wall Transmission Service

A full transmission service for your Great Wall involves more than just draining and refilling fluid. Our approach uses our Snap-On diagnostic equipment to identify the real fault before we start any work, so you know exactly what’s needed.

First, we connect your Great Wall to our diagnostic scanner to read any transmission-related fault codes and check how the gearbox is performing. This tells us whether the issue is electrical, mechanical, or fluid-related. We then inspect the transmission fluid itself, checking its colour, smell, and condition. Dark, burnt-smelling fluid or fluid with metal particles suggests internal wear that needs to be addressed.

The service itself includes draining the old transmission fluid, replacing the transmission filter, and refilling with fluid that meets Great Wall’s OEM specifications. Some Great Wall models benefit from a full fluid flush if the gearbox has been working hard or the fluid is severely degraded. We use genuine or OEM-equivalent fluids, not cheap substitutes that can cause shifting problems or internal damage.

We also inspect the transmission pan for debris, check seals and gaskets for leaks, and test the vehicle to confirm smooth shifting through all gears. If we find electronic issues, we address those separately from the fluid service. Throughout the process, we keep you informed about what we’ve found and what it means for your vehicle’s ongoing reliability.

Factors That Affect Cost and Time for Great Wall Transmission Work

The cost of a Great Wall transmission service depends on several factors. Routine fluid and filter service is straightforward and relatively quick. If your gearbox needs a full fluid flush or if we find fault codes that require electrical diagnostics, the time and cost increase accordingly.

Parts availability also plays a role. Great Wall transmissions use OEM-specific filters and fluids, and we source these locally where possible. If we identify that your transmission requires more than routine servicing, we’ll explain the options clearly before proceeding. Some repairs are straightforward adjustments or seal replacements; others may require specialist work, and we’ll be honest about what’s realistic and what’s not.

The age and mileage of your Great Wall matters too. High-mileage gearboxes that have never had a fluid change often need a gentler approach, and we’ll discuss the best strategy for your vehicle’s condition. Newer models with electronic transmission control systems may need diagnostic verification to rule out sensor or wiring issues before we assume the fluid itself is the problem.

Great Wall transmission service intervals depend on your model and driving conditions. Most Great Wall vehicles benefit from transmission fluid and filter checks every 40,000 to 60,000 kilometres, with more thorough servicing every 80,000 to 100,000 kilometres. Stop-start city driving in Mackay’s traffic can require more frequent checks than highway use. We’ll review your vehicle’s service schedule and driving patterns to recommend the right interval for you.

No, servicing your Great Wall at an independent workshop does not automatically void your manufacturer warranty. Australian consumer law, as outlined by the ACCC, generally allows owners to have vehicles serviced by qualified independent mechanics without affecting warranty coverage. The key is that work must be performed to a professional standard using genuine or OEM-equivalent parts. We use genuine and OEM-spec parts for all Great Wall work. For specific warranty questions about your vehicle, check your handbook or contact your Great Wall dealer.

Transmission fluid and transmission oil are essentially the same thing in modern vehicles. Automatic transmissions use transmission fluid which lubricates, cools, and transfers power between components. Over time, this fluid degrades and breaks down, losing its ability to protect your transmission. Quality fluid is critical to transmission longevity. Using the correct specification fluid for your Great Wall model is important, which is why we always install the right product for your vehicle.

Driving with the transmission warning light on is risky and not recommended. The light indicates a fault detected by your vehicle’s electronic systems, ranging from minor sensor issues to serious transmission problems. Continuing to drive could cause further damage and make repairs more expensive. Have your Great Wall checked by a qualified mechanic as soon as possible. We can run full diagnostics to identify the exact issue and advise you on safe next steps.

Fresh transmission fluid is typically bright red and has a slight sweet smell. Over time it becomes dark brown or black and smells burnt, which signals it’s broken down and losing effectiveness. You can check the level and colour using the dipstick when your engine is warm. If the fluid looks dark or smells burnt, it needs replacing. Regular servicing prevents fluid degradation and keeps your transmission protected and running smoothly.

Skipping transmission servicing allows fluid to degrade, which reduces lubrication, increases heat, and causes internal wear to accelerate. Over time, this leads to rough shifts, slipping, and eventually transmission failure. Transmission repairs or replacement are among the most expensive work on a vehicle. Regular servicing catches problems early and costs far less than dealing with major failure. Preventative maintenance is the smartest investment you can make for your transmission’s longevity.
